Hi,

 

Just like many, many others I've been trying to unlock Auf Wiedersehen Petrovic, but so far unfortunately without success. I did read the wonderful Multiplayer guide and followed all steps (check-doublecheck whether the money adds up, check if both players stay in the game, no disconnects, won all teamgames by being the highest ranked player without others leaving etc, both variants of Cops n Crooks in a single match etc). Still no trophy sadly... 

 

However, I am still playing on my original save from 2009. I started GTA IV back then and did try to boost Auf Wiedersehen Petrovic (but it was messy due to bad internet at my boostingpartners side). I then gave up when I ticked everything off twice and had at least one win according to the leaderboards, but without trophy. 

I decided to gave it another go last year, with the 2014 patch, and boosted everything again with my brother and a friend. This time without disconnects, by following the guide on this site. Still no trophy. :(

 

I've given it another go the last few days and we boosted every teamgame again and all Race > Cannonballs and Freerun's. Still no trophy.

 

I'm starting to wonder if my save is f#cked because I started in 2009 and continued after the patch. Maybe the profile data things I already earned the trophy and that's why it doesn't pop?

 

So my question is: Is there anyone that started the MP pre-patch and continued after the patch on the same Profile data and did actually unlock Auf Wiedersehen Petrovic? Or am I better off deleting the Profile data and starting from scratch? This trophy is driving me nuts.

Look up what P2P means and how it works, it means peer to peer, no servers needed except the ones needed to login to PSN but they never track game progress.
Or do you really think they would keep the PS3 servers for GTAIV up longer than the ones for GTAV and Max Payne 3?

 

Socialclub and servers for GTAIV and Red dead redemption went down when the gamespy servers went down.

They fixed both to be P2P and that's the only reason they still work today and will keep on working as long as PSN on PS3 works.


Progress is now saved on your savefile but you still need to go through it all legit, no shortcut (apart maybe from cheating with CFW or so).

Rest assured he went through it with that sheet multiple times following all tips about checking the money after each game and connection checking and so on...

 

But the culprit was found: Bomb da base... He decided to do the coop missions 1 more time because it was the only thing left he only did 3 times while going for AWP and now it popped.

He already had the fly the coop trophy for which he did this mission multiple times (before the patch) apart from the times he did it for AWP so it shows something is really off with the tracking, even nowadays all the tricks don't guarantee it.

Final conclusion: The save was not completely corrupted from playing both before and after the patch but tracking is still annoying even when following all the tips about having a chat open and checking your money after each game.
